Single-Cell Sequencing Technology and Its Research Progress in Plant cells

Abstract:

Traditional sequencing technology requires bulk sample to provide an average view of gene expression and ignore the information of gene expression heterogeneity between individual cells. Single-cell sequencing, as an emerging technology, provides new ideas for solving the above problems. Currently, this technique has been wildly used in animal cell studies, but fewly used in plants cell. This review mainly focuses on the development history and key technologies of single-cell sequencing technology, with special emphasis on the research progress in plant cells, which will provide valuable information for further study on plant single-cell genome and transcriptome sequencing.
